Understanding Age-Related Macular Degeneration
AMD is a progressive eye condition that affects the macula, the central part of the retina responsible for sharp, detailed vision. The macula allows us to see fine details clearly, such as reading small print, recognizing faces, and driving. As AMD advances, central vision becomes blurred or distorted, making these everyday activities increasingly difficult.
There are two main types of AMD: dry and wet. Dry AMD is the more common form, accounting for about 85-90% of cases. It occurs when the light-sensitive cells in the macula slowly break down, leading to a gradual loss of central vision. Wet AMD, though less common, tends to progress more rapidly and is caused by abnormal blood vessels growing underneath the retina, which can leak fluid or blood, causing sudden and severe vision loss.
Understanding these distinctions is important because the cause and progression of each type differ, influencing treatment approaches and patient outcomes. While no cure currently exists for AMD, early detection and proper management can help slow vision loss and maintain independence.
Causes and Risk Factors of AMD
The exact cause of AMD is not fully understood, but it is generally linked to a combination of genetic, environmental, and lifestyle factors. Age remains the most significant risk factor, with the likelihood of developing AMD increasing substantially after age 50. Other risk factors that have been identified include genetics, smoking, diet, and exposure to ultraviolet light.
Genetics plays a crucial role; individuals with a family history of AMD are more likely to develop the condition. Research has identified specific gene variations that increase susceptibility, although lifestyle factors can still influence the severity and progression. Smoking is one of the most significant modifiable risk factors, with smokers having up to a fourfold increased risk of developing AMD compared to nonsmokers. Poor nutrition and diets low in antioxidants and omega-3 fatty acids have also been associated with increased risk, as these nutrients help protect retinal cells from oxidative damage.
Additionally, prolonged exposure to ultraviolet light and high-energy blue light may contribute to retinal damage over time. Other health conditions, such as obesity, cardiovascular disease, and high blood pressure, can also increase the likelihood of AMD by affecting blood flow and the health of retinal tissues. The interplay between these factors makes AMD a complex condition, underscoring the importance of regular eye exams and comprehensive lifestyle management.
Symptoms and Early Detection
AMD can often develop without noticeable symptoms in its early stages, which is why regular eye examinations are essential for early diagnosis. The earliest signs may include mild blurring or distortion in central vision. Some people may notice straight lines appearing wavy or dark spots in their vision, known as scotomas.
As the disease progresses, difficulty reading, recognizing faces, and performing tasks that require sharp vision becomes more apparent. Peripheral vision is typically unaffected, meaning patients may not realize the extent of central vision loss until the condition has advanced. The difference in symptom onset between dry and wet AMD is significant; wet AMD can cause sudden and dramatic changes in vision, making prompt diagnosis and treatment critical.
Advanced diagnostic tools such as optical coherence tomography (OCT) and fluorescein angiography enable eye care providers to detect AMD before symptoms worsen. These imaging technologies help monitor the retina’s condition and track disease progression, guiding timely intervention. Understanding symptoms and maintaining routine eye care can lead to earlier detection, when management strategies are most effective.
Management and Treatment Options
While AMD cannot be cured, various management and treatment options are available to slow its progression and help preserve vision. The approach varies depending on whether the patient has dry or wet AMD.
For dry AMD, management focuses primarily on lifestyle modifications and nutritional support. The Age-Related Eye Disease Study (AREDS) demonstrated that high-dose antioxidant vitamins and minerals, including vitamins C and E, zinc, copper, and lutein, can reduce the risk of progression in intermediate to advanced stages. Patients are encouraged to maintain a healthy diet rich in leafy green vegetables, fish, and nuts, which provide essential nutrients to support retinal health. Quitting smoking and protecting eyes from UV exposure are also critical components of AMD management.
Wet AMD requires more aggressive treatment to control abnormal blood vessel growth. Anti-vascular endothelial growth factor (anti-VEGF) injections have revolutionized wet AMD care by inhibiting the growth of these vessels and reducing fluid leakage. These injections, typically administered monthly or as needed, can help stabilize or even improve vision in many patients. In some cases, photodynamic therapy or laser treatments may be used to target abnormal vessels directly.
In addition to medical interventions, low vision aids and rehabilitation can help patients adapt to changes in their vision. Magnifiers, special lighting, and electronic devices help optimize remaining vision and improve daily functioning. Counseling and support groups also play an important role in assisting individuals to cope with the emotional impact of vision loss.
Living with AMD: Preventive and Supportive Strategies
Living with AMD involves more than just medical treatment; it requires a proactive approach to eye health and overall well-being. Regular follow-ups with eye care professionals ensure ongoing monitoring and adjustment of management strategies. Patients are advised to be vigilant about any new changes in vision and report these promptly.
Adopting a lifestyle that promotes vascular and retinal health can have lasting benefits. This includes maintaining a balanced diet, exercising regularly to improve cardiovascular health, and managing chronic conditions like hypertension and diabetes. Wearing sunglasses that block UV rays and blue light can reduce retinal stress.
Supportive care is equally important, especially as vision loss progresses. Family members and caregivers can assist by helping with orientation and mobility training, as well as facilitating the use of assistive technologies. Emotional support and mental health resources are vital components, as vision loss can lead to isolation and depression.
